When considering this option, one of the most commonly requested questions is, "How long do dental implants final on average?"
On average, dental implants can last anywhere from ten to thirty years, sometimes even longer with correct care. Factors similar to the type of material used, the dentist's experience, and the patient’s general health play a big position in their longevity. Titanium is essentially the most commonly used material for implants as a result of its biocompatibility, that means the physique accepts it well.
Implants are surgically positioned into the jawbone, the place they fuse with the bone in a process known as osseointegration. This integration offers a sturdy foundation for the replacement teeth. Once the implants have successfully built-in, they can present a secure base for crowns, bridges, or dentures, making certain a extra natural really feel and aesthetic result.

The maintenance of dental implants is essential for their lifespan. Regular dental check-ups and correct oral hygiene, including brushing and flossing, significantly contribute to the longevity of implants. Neglecting oral hygiene can result in peri-implantitis, an inflammatory condition that can jeopardize the soundness of the implant.
Other health elements additionally affect the durability of dental implants. Conditions corresponding to diabetes, osteoporosis, or autoimmune illnesses can complicate the healing course of and affect the longevity of the implant. It's important to debate your medical history with a dental professional before present process the process.

Lifestyle decisions further influence how long dental implants last. Smoking, for instance, has been proven to increase the risk of implant failure. The nicotine in tobacco merchandise constricts blood vessels, hindering correct healing. Patients are sometimes inspired to stop smoking previous to surgery and maintain a smoke-free life-style after the procedure.
The ability level of the dentist or oral surgeon performing the process can't be ignored. An skilled professional will guarantee proper placement and reduce issues during and after the surgery. Seeking a certified implant specialist can be crucial for reaching one of the best outcomes.
The location of the implant also matters. For occasion, implants placed in areas with thick, healthy bone have the next success rate than these placed in regions with skinny bone. great site If a patient has insufficient bone density, bone grafting could also be needed earlier than placing the implant. This added procedure can affect the general timeline and durability.

While dental implants can last a long time, the prosthetic parts, similar to crowns or dentures, may require replacement each 5 to 15 years. Wear and tear from common use or modifications within the mouth can necessitate updates. Thus, it's necessary for sufferers to be aware that whereas the implant itself can last many years, the visible elements may need consideration.
Patients must also monitor their general oral health, ensuring that any present dental points are addressed promptly. Regular dental check-ups might help establish problems such as gum disease that might affect the longevity of not simply the implants, but natural teeth as properly. A proactive method can aid in preserving both natural and synthetic teeth.
